Detailed Itinerary

Day 1 Nairobi to Masai Mara National Reserve
  • Begin your day with a hearty breakfast from 7:00 to 7:30 AM.
  • Start your drive to the legendary Masai Mara National Reserve, one of the last havens where wildlife roams freely in numbers reminiscent of Africa’s untamed past.
  • The Maasai Mara is the northern extension of the Serengeti and serves as the stage for the awe-inspiring Great Wildebeest Migration, where thousands of wildebeest, zebras, and predators journey across the plains.
  • After an exciting game drive, enjoy lunch from 12:00 to 1:00 PM.
  • Experience an afternoon game drive following lunch.
  • After your afternoon adventure, return to your camp for dinner and a cozy overnight stay at a luxury camp.

After a hearty breakfast from 7:00 to 7:30 AM, embark with your packed lunch for a full day of exhilarating game drive in the Masai Mara, have your delicious picnic lunch in the wild from 12:00 to 1:30 PM. Maasai Mara is Known for its iconic black-maned lions and diverse wildlife, the Maasai Mara offers a unique chance to spot the Big Five including elephants, lions, leopards, buffaloes and rhinos. The most interesting thing is that during this game drive you may be able to spot cheetahs which sometimes climb on top of a car where you will have a better view.  Bird lovers will be thrilled with nearly 500 recorded species, including majestic eagles, striking hawks, and the colossal Kori bustard. After a beautiful adventure, you will be taken back to your camp by our guide to enjoy a sumptuous dinner and unwind with a luxurious overnight stay at your camp.

On this day start with your early morning after a hot breakfast from 6:00 to 6:30 AM followed by a morning game drive through the Masai Mara as we journey towards the Serengeti. The journey to the Sirali border will take about three hours then after completing the border formalities we will embark on a scenic drive to Serengeti National Park in Tanzania about two hours from the border. Lunch will be at Serengeti National Park from 1:00 to 2:00 PM. Although it’s a full day of travel, the game drive en route offers incredible wildlife sightings where during the drive explore wild animals such as lions, zebras, impalas and wildebeests. After a beautiful adventure, embark to the lodge where we will enjoy a delicious dinner and relax with a comfortable overnight stay at your camp

Embark on a full-day game drive in Serengeti National Park, have your breakfast from 7:00 to 7:30 AM. As you crest the hillside, the Serengeti unfolds in a breathtaking panorama of endless plains. True to its name, Serengeti—meaning "endless plains" in Kiswahili—spans 18,000 sq. km (6,900 sq. miles) and is home to over two million large mammals. Witness the grandeur of more than a million wildebeest, hundreds of thousands of zebras, and Thomson's gazelles, with majestic predators like lions, cheetahs, and hyenas prowling in pursuit. The park is also alive with smaller creatures such as rock hyraxes, bat-eared foxes, and nearly 500 bird species which you will be able to spot during the adventure. After having your lunch from 1:00 to 2:00 PM, you will have an afternoon game drive to evening about 4:30 PM then your guide will drive you back to the Lodge for you to  settle in for a delightful dinner and an overnight stay. 

Rise early for a pre-breakfast safari from 6:30 to 7:00 AM and immerse yourself in the magic of an African sunrise—a true morning Serengeti.  Then you will have your morning game drive which will take about three hours where you will be able to see the beauty of Serengeti with a variety of Plant and animal species. After the game drive you will  have lunch from 12:00 to 1:00 PM. After lunch, you will start the journey to exit Serengeti and drive to Lodge  in karatu via ngorongoro Highlands where you will have your dinner and spend your night.

In the morning after breakfast from 7:00 to 7:30 AM, embark on game drive to Ngorongoro Crater immerse yourself to see different animal species such as elephants, lions hyenas, gazelles, zebras, black rhinos and bird species for a short time. After a game drive in the crater, have your lunch beside a serene hippo pool called Ngoitokitok from 1:00 to 2:00 PM. Upon your lunch, you will start your journey to exit Ngorongoro crater to Arusha. En route, you will see Lake Makati which provides water to animals found in the crater.  We aim to return to Arusha by around 5:00 PM, with flexibility to accommodate flight schedules or other needs.
